Man assaulted landscaper with tile near 21st Ave, Sacramento CA
An assault occurred near 21st Avenue where a landscaper reported that a neighbor hit him with a piece of tile and concrete and spat on him. No medical attention was needed.

Police codes explained
The following codes appeared in the transcript and are explained below:
[1]
245: Assault with a deadly weapon or force likely to cause great bodily injury.
